Does A Kite Have 1 Axis Of Symmetry?
We see that a kite is a special quadrilateral in which one of its two diagonals (long and short) is also its axis of symmetry, and if you fold the kite along that diagonal, the two halves will match up exactly (i.e. they are congruent).

How Many Lines Of Symmetry Does Each Have?
A shape can have more than one line of symmetry. Thus a rectangle has two lines of symmetry, an equilateral triangle has three lines of symmetry, and a square has four. A circle has an infinite number of lines of symmetry since it can be folded about any diameter.

Should A Kite Be Symmetrical?
Note on symmetrical / asymmetrical kites Although in general, kites are made symmetrical– some specialist kitemakers do make asymmetrical kites and then they need bridling in a special way to support the kite in a balanced way across the whole sail area.

What Makes A Kite A Kite?
A kite is a quadrilateral that has 2 pairs of equal-length sides and these sides are adjacent to each other. Properties: The two angles are equal where the unequal sides meet. It can be viewed as a pair of congruent triangles with a common base. It has 2 diagonals that intersect each other at right angles.
How Do You Prove A Kite?
A kite is a quadrilateral with two pairs of adjacent sides, congruent. A kite also has perpendicular diagonals, where one bisects the other. You can use either of these things to determine if a quadrilateral is a kite.

Why Is My Kite Flipping?
This is usually caused by your lines going slack after a crash while you continue accelerating towards the kite. Your kite then flips over which inverts it. In a lot of cases, you won’t be able to control your kite anymore as the canopy inverts and often some bridles get wrapped around your kite as well.
Is A Kite A Parallelogram?
Is a kite a parallelogram?
No, a kite is not a parallelogram. The opposite sides in a parallelogram are parallel. In a kite, there are no parallel sides.

What Is The Order Of Symmetry In Math?
The number of positions in which a figure can be rotated and still appears exactly as it did before the rotation, is called the order of symmetry. For example, a star can be rotated 5 times along its tip and look at the same every time. Hence, its order of symmetry is 5.
